15 PERSONS ARRAIGNED IN COURT OVER ILLEGAL COLLECTION OF REVENUE IN ANAMBRA

 

ANJET operations as an outfit to enforce compliance with the stipulated regulations that forbid touting, illegal revenue collection, as well as running of unauthorized private motor parks and related matters in the state.

A total of 15 persons who have been apprehended since 28/09/22 for defaulting in the areas mentioned above were arraigned at the Magistrate Court 3, Awka today. 


Out of these 15 persons who were arraigned, 8 were granted bail by His Worship C. Nonyelum after perfecting their bail conditions and as their sureties were equally available, while the remaining 7 were remanded in Amawbia prison. 

The agency (ANJET) warn touts and criminal elements in the state to repent or face the law. 

The case was adjourned to 27th of October, 2022.
